This is another post about some of the murals seen around Rochester. As you may have noticed, there are many!

below: A small tree grows in front of a mural of stripes, rectangles, and other shapes

below: What big feet you have!

below: That foot, and the skin tight boot, belongs to this man, the creation of Swedish artist Andreas Englund who likes to paint people in grey superhero outfits with scanty red pants. This was part of Wall/Therapy 2015.

below: The abstract painting in greens and blues is the work of Nova.

below: Skull surrounded by moths, butterflies and flowers that seem to be growing out of it in a work titled “Cosmos” by Nico Cathcart as part of Wall/Therapy. Painted in Sept 2021.

below: Letters and symbols

below: Pink face but with only one visible eye, by Sam Rodriguez, 2014.

below: Omen (from Montreal) painted this woman lying on her side with her eyes closed.

below: The World is Yours by Queen Andrea (as in Letter Queen!), 2014.

below: Super Fresh

below: Mural by Pixel Pancho, a boy embracing a robot that has seen better days.


below: “Mother” by Maxxer242 aka Max Gramajo, painted in Sept 2021

below: Another mural featuring text.. A Word is an Image, by Shoe aka Niels Shoe Meulman. Image is written in very large letters spread out across the black wall.


below: Four quadrants of an eye and cheekbone is all that remain of a once larger mural by Daze aka Chris Ellis.

Photos taken May 2023
Some of these murals appeared in an earlier blog post titled, “murals, Rochester NY” from Dec 2015.
